Dear Friends of Hope ~

I brought the pup for a visit to my daughter and her husband's apartment.  I took her out for a potty run (the pup, not my daughter!), made a few turns, and somehow got lost.  Even though I am a full grown adult, but I still experienced a moment of panic. Now, I regularly get lost, but it usually involves a car and more complicated directions (OK maybe not so complicated).  It's true I have a habit of not always knowing where I am but, really?  Getting lost after basically just trying to go around the block?  God didn't bless me with one of those inner GPS's that my husband and daughter have…………but He DID give me an entire book of directions on not only where to go, but how to live!  Check out these couple verses – "Whether you turn to the right or to the left, you ears will hear a voice behind you, saying, 'This is the way; walk in it." (Isaiah 30:21) and "Stand at the crossroads and look; ask for the ancient paths, ask where the good way is, and walk in it, and you will find rest for your souls."  (Jeremiah 6:16) and finally "I will instruct you and teach you in the way you should go…" (Psalm 32:8) If you are directionally challenged like me, take comfort in knowing that, while we may not always know where we are physically, we can always know where we should go spiritually.  Make a habit of checking in with God and listening for His direction.  He will show you the path to take………….AND you will find rest for your soul!

 

SUNDAY MORNING MESSAGE

October 18 – Doubt and Faith (John 20:19-31)

COMMUNION

It would be nice if we had all the answers we ever needed – no more questions and no more confusion.  But life does not work that way.  God has designed us to question what we see and what we don't know.  We are driven to pursue mysteries and the unknown.  This can be productive or destructive.  Some of us waste our time trying to figure out what's coming – we call it worry!  But many times, what we don't know is the catalyst to learning and growing.  It's the same thing with doubt.  As people of faith, we sometimes think of doubt as a defect in our faith.  But we're going to look at one of the most famous stories of doubt in the Bible, and Jesus' reaction to those who are in doubt and fear.  Maybe faith can grow and even flourish right next to our doubts and fears.

THE GREAT COMMISSION – WHY HCF SUPPORTS MISSIONARIES

Matthew 28:16-20

"Then the eleven disciples went to Galilee, to the mountain where Jesus had told them to go. When they saw him, they worshiped him; but some doubted. Then Jesus came to them and said, "All authority in heaven and on earth has been given to me. Therefore go and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it, and teaching them to obey everything I have commanded you. And surely I am with you always, to the very end of the age."
